Looking for mobile app for IMAP mail

For FM and Gsuite they have original native Apps on mobile that is good.
For PC/Mac I always use Thunderbird for client.
But I have dozens of roundcube mail accounts for which I cannot find good mobile App.
I tried everyone almost in AppStore but got no luck. Their experience has huge differences than FM/GM apps.
Do you have any suggestions ( I use latest iOS). Thank you.

After ditching Edison (for privacy concerns, maybe unfounded) I tried Spark but I didn't like it (can't remember why) and a couple of others and settled on Airmail. I'm very happy with it. It's not free but I prefer to pay rather than 'be the product' as they say.

It's easy enough to load a few and seevwhivh you find yourself using most often....
